Brooklyn plots to identify co-expression dysregulation in single cell sequencing

2023-06-24

Abstract excerpt

<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> Altered open chromatin regions, impacting gene expression, is a feature of some human disorders. We discovered it is possible to detect global changes in genomically-related gene co-expression within single cell RNA sequencing (scRNA-seq) data.
